limitrophe noun & adjective.
['lɪmɪtrǝʊf] L16.[French from late Latin limitrophus, formed as LIMIT noun + Greek -trophos supporting, from trephein support, nourish.]A. noun. A borderland. Long
rare.
L16.b. adjective. Situated on a frontier; adjacent
to another country.
